Hapert is located in the province of Noord-Brabant, in the municipality of Bladel The district has a total area of 2.022 hectares, of which 2.012 hectares are land and 10 hectares are water. The district is coded as WK172802. The postcode area is 5527AA-5527PA.

Residents

Hapert has 5.755 residents. Of these, 50,7% are men and 49,3%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(28,4%). The other age groups are 23,0% for '65 years or older', 22,9% for '25 to 45 years', 14,2% for '0 to 15 years' and 11,5% for '15 to 25 years'. Of the residents, 43,6% is unmarried, 44,0% is married, 7,2% is divorced and 5,1% is widowed. 5.040 residents originate from the Netherlands, 460 come from Europe and 260 come from countries outside Europe.

There are 2.515 households in Hapert. 29,8% of these are single-person households, 35,2% households without children and 35,0% households with children. The average household size is 2,3 persons.

In Hapert there are 4.800 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€36.000, which is €200 (1%) higher than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€30.800, which is €1.600 (5%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Hapert are educated to an intermediate level. 48,1%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 26,4%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O) and 25,5%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).

Of the 5.755 residents, around 71% are in paid employment, which amounts to 4.086 people. This is 6% higher than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(84%), while 16% are self-employed. In Hapert, 25%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 1.180 people receive this benefit.

Housing

In Hapert there are 2.481 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€405.000. Of these, around 97% are occupied and 3%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 24% rental homes and 76%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 77% privately owned, 16% owned by housing associations and 7%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in Hapert are 1970-1980 (28%) and 1950-1970 (21%).

Energy

In Hapert there are 3.261 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are C (25%), A (25%) and D (18%). On average, an address in Hapert uses 3.080 kWh of electricity per year. This is 10% above the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 1.190 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 7%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
